This project is an application skeleton (initial scaffolding or template) for a typical modern AngularJS web app.
- Latest version of AngularJS;
- Yarn as package manager;
- Gulp for building;
- Folders-by-Feature structure;
- Component-based design;
- AngularUI Router for client-side routing;
- Data calls through services;
- ECMAScript 6 (arrow functions, strings interpolation);
- Browsersync;
- Bootstrap - on the bootstrap branch.
- clone or download
yarn
gulp build
- Angular 1 Style Guide by John Papa
- AngularJS styleguide (ES2015) by Todd Motto
- AngularJS with Gulp Step by Step by Mark Winterbottom
- Designing and Building Component-based AngularJS Applications by Miguel Castro
- Ultimate AngularJS Component Oriented Design Guide by Gautier Delorme